[ ] Safe replacement lock — Harwick office run. Collect the new lock assembly from Venner Lockworks, still in its factory-sealed carton; do not open it. Verify the carton seal is intact and photograph it before loading. Keep it in the cab, not the cargo bay, for the entire trip. At delivery, the courier must follow the instruction below.

handover note for bafof-bawif: the praok sorox courier leaves the eliox ledger at gate 3435 under passcode 620472

**14:22 UTC** — So this is when things got weird. DeployDuck, our chat bot that posts deploy status to the Marlow support channel, started replying "all green" to every query even though the Fenwick rollout had stalled at 40%. Turns out its cache never invalidated after the orchestrator restart. Support folks were telling customers things were fine when they weren't. Sorry about that. The stale responses traced back to the following build.

build token for kagaf-hahof: htk14_9d3d4d26d7d8de

Handover — GraphTrellis (dependency graph visualizer)

For the weekly eng sync: I'm passing GraphTrellis to Dov. Rendering is stable; the cycle-detection overlay still flickers on large monorepos, tracked in the backlog. The layout cache lives in an encrypted volume that must be mounted before the nightly rebuild. To mount it on a fresh machine, you'll need the recovery passphrase below.

unlock words, tawif-tahop: oliys-ulawyn-tamdor-lamys-casox-jormir-fraius-kasath-ulador-ulamir-holir-sorys-holeth

## Thumbnail queue backing up (Snapkettle)

If the thumb queue in Snapkettle climbs past ~5k, it's almost always a stuck worker holding a lease. Restart the `thumbgen` pool first, then requeue orphaned jobs with the admin script. If that doesn't clear it, hit the queue inspector API for per-job state, authenticating with the bearer token below.

portal login ticket: eyJhbGciOiJIUzI1NiIsInR5cCI6IkpXVCJ9.eyJzdWIiOiIMjvRAf3PEFIn0.nuv9gjixLtnr